In a later study, O'Connor & Hermelin (1991) noted that the mean IQ of savants with autism was considerably higher than that of non-savants (non-verbal IQ 72 versus 52; verbal IQ equivalent 70 versus 59).What is the IQ of a savant with autism?
The general IQ of the autistic savant group ranged between 36 and 128 with a mean of 83.3 (S.D. =23.9).Are people with savant syndrome intelligent?
savant syndrome, rare condition wherein a person of less than normal intelligence or severely limited emotional range has prodigious intellectual gifts in a specific area. Mathematical, musical, artistic, and mechanical abilities have been among the talents demonstrated by savants.What is the highest IQ ever savant?

What are the 3 types of savants?
The triad of mental disability, blindness and musical genius occurs with a curious, conspicuous frequency in reports over this past century. Artistic talent, usually painting or drawing, is seen next most frequently.What is the average IQ of a savant?
Savantism disproportionately affects males, with about five male savants for every one female, and the syndrome generally occurs in people with IQs between 40 and 70.Can a normal person be a savant?
(f) Savant syndrome can be congenital or it can be acquiredHowever, 'acquired' savant skills can also appear, when none were previously present, in neurotypical individuals following brain injury or disease later in infancy, childhood or adult life (Lythgoe et al.

Savant syndrome is a rare condition where someone with a developmental or intellectual disability shows extreme giftedness in one or more areas.What do savants struggle with?
While many savants struggle with language and comprehension (skills associated primarily with the left hemisphere), they often have amazing skills in mathematics and memory (primarily right hemisphere skills).Is Asperger's the same as savant?
Savant skills, while not universally present in Asperger's persons, are very common, and generally include prodigious memory. When they do occur, in my experience, those special abilities in Asperger's tend to involve numbers, mathematics, mechanical and spatial skills.What is Snoop Dogg's IQ?
